Red Hot Cyber
La cybersecurity è condivisione. Riconosci il rischio, combattilo, condividi le tue esperienze ed incentiva gli altri a fare meglio di te.
Cerca
Red Hot Cyber Academy

Un file Zip compresso con una doppia password? Si, è possibile!

Redazione RHC : 23 Agosto 2022 09:00

Gli archivi ZIP protetti da password sono mezzi comuni per comprimere e condividere set di file, da documenti sensibili a campioni di malware fino a file anche dannosi (ad es. “fatture” di phishing nelle e-mail).

Ma sapevi che è possibile che un file ZIP crittografato abbia due password corrette, con entrambe che producono lo stesso risultato quando viene estratto il file ZIP?

Arseniy Sharoglazov, un ricercatore di sicurezza informatica presso Positive Technologies, ha condiviso durante il fine settimana un semplice esperimento in cui ha prodotto un file ZIP protetto da password chiamato x.zip.

Iscriviti GRATIS ai WorkShop Hands-On della RHC Conference 2025 (Giovedì 8 maggio 2025)

Il giorno giovedì 8 maggio 2025 presso il teatro Italia di Roma (a due passi dalla stazione termini e dalla metro B di Piazza Bologna), si terranno i workshop "hands-on", creati per far avvicinare i ragazzi (o persone di qualsiasi età) alla sicurezza informatica e alla tecnologia. Questo anno i workshop saranno:

  • Creare Un Sistema Ai Di Visual Object Tracking (Hands on)
  • Social Engineering 2.0: Alla Scoperta Delle Minacce DeepFake
  • Doxing Con Langflow: Stiamo Costruendo La Fine Della Privacy?
  • Come Hackerare Un Sito WordPress (Hands on)
  • Il Cyberbullismo Tra Virtuale E Reale
  • Come Entrare Nel Dark Web In Sicurezza (Hands on)

  • Potete iscrivervi gratuitamente all'evento, che è stato creato per poter ispirare i ragazzi verso la sicurezza informatica e la tecnologia.
    Per ulteriori informazioni, scrivi a [email protected] oppure su Whatsapp al 379 163 8765


    Supporta RHC attraverso:


    Ti piacciono gli articoli di Red Hot Cyber? Non aspettare oltre, iscriviti alla newsletter settimanale per non perdere nessun articolo.

    La password scelta da Sharoglazov per crittografare il suo ZIP era un gioco di parole sul successo del 1987  che è diventato un popolare meme tecnologico:

    Nev1r-G0nna-G2ve-Y8u-Up-N5v1r-G1nna-Let-Y4u-D1wn-N8v4r-G5nna-D0sert-You

    Ma il ricercatore ha dimostrato che durante l’estrazione di x.zip  utilizzando una password completamente diversa, non ha ricevuto messaggi di errore.

    Infatti, l’utilizzo della password diversa ha comportato la corretta estrazione del file ZIP, con il contenuto originale intatto.

    La rivista BleepingComputer ha cercato di riprodurre l’esperimento utilizzando  diversi programmi ZIP come p7zip (equivalente a 7-Zip per macOS) e Keka .

    Come l’archivio ZIP del ricercatore, il file è stato creato con la medesima password e con la modalità di crittografia AES-256 abilitata.

    Mentre lo ZIP è stato crittografato con la password più lunga, utilizzando una delle due password è stato estratto l’archivio con successo.

    La password in questione è la seguente:

    pkH8a0AqNbHcdw8GrmSp

    Quando si producono archivi ZIP protetti da password con la modalità AES-256 abilitata, il formato ZIP utilizza l’ algoritmo  PBKDF2 e esegue l’hashing della password fornita dall’utente, se la password è troppo lunga. Per troppo lunga si intende più di 64 byte, spiega il ricercatore.

    Invece della password scelta dall’utente (in questo caso ” Nev1r-G0nna-G2ve-…” ) questo hash appena calcolato diventa la password effettiva del file.

    Quando l’utente tenta di estrarre il file e inserisce una password più lunga di 64 byte (” Nev1r-G0nna-G2ve-…  “), l’input dell’utente verrà nuovamente sottoposto a hash dall’applicazione ZIP e confrontato con quello corretto password (che ora è esso stesso un hash). Una corrispondenza porterebbe a un’estrazione di file riuscita.

    La password alternativa utilizzata in questo esempio (” pkH8a0AqNbHcdw8GrmSp “) è in effetti una rappresentazione ASCII dell’hash SHA-1 della password più lunga .

    Checksum SHA-1 di “Nev1r-G0nna-G2ve-…” = 706b4838613041714e624863647773847726d5370.

    Questo checksum quando convertito in ASCII produce: pkH8a0AqNbHcdw8GrmSp

    Si noti, tuttavia, che durante la crittografia o la decrittografia di un file, il processo di hashing si verifica solo se la lunghezza della password è maggiore di 64 caratteri.

    In altre parole, le password più brevi non verranno sottoposte a hash in nessuna fase di compressione o decompressione dello ZIP.

    Redazione
    La redazione di Red Hot Cyber è composta da un insieme di persone fisiche e fonti anonime che collaborano attivamente fornendo informazioni in anteprima e news sulla sicurezza informatica e sull'informatica in generale.

    Lista degli articoli

    Articoli in evidenza

    HackerHood di RHC Rivela due nuovi 0day sui prodotti Zyxel

    Il collettivo di ricerca in sicurezza informatica HackerHood, parte dell’universo della community di Red Hot Cyber, ha recentemente scoperto due nuove vulnerabilità ...

    A lezione di IA a 6 anni: la Cina prepara i suoi bambini alla rivoluzione dell’intelligenza artificiale

    La Cina introdurrà corsi di intelligenza artificiale per gli studenti delle scuole primarie e secondarie questo autunno. L’iniziativa prevede che i bambini a partire dai sei anni imparino ...

    Attacco Hacker a 4chan! Dove è nato Anonymous, probabilmente chiuderà per sempre

    L’imageboard di 4chan è praticamente inattivo da lunedì sera (14 aprile), apparentemente a causa di un attacco hacker. I membri dell’imageboard Soyjak party (noto anche semplic...

    Zero-day su iPhone, Mac e iPad: Apple corre ai ripari con patch d’emergenza

    Apple ha rilasciato patch di emergenza per correggere due vulnerabilità zero-day. Secondo l’azienda, questi problemi sono stati sfruttati in attacchi mirati ed “estremamen...

    CVE e MITRE salvato dagli USA. L’Europa spettatrice inerme della propria Sicurezza Nazionale

    Quanto accaduto in questi giorni deve rappresentare un campanello d’allarme per l’Europa.Mentre il programma CVE — pilastro della sicurezza informatica globale — rischiava ...